    CM DTMF not working on direct SIP to CMM 7.x

    Hi all,

    I have a CMM on the latest 7.0 and the CM is latest 7.1 as of 11/21/17. They have direct SIP integration. Internal and external calls to the CMM get through and you can hear it say welcome to Audix. Please enter your mailbox and press #. Digit tones (DTMF signalling) are not heard by the CMM. I followed the Implementation doc here: https://downloads.avaya.com/css/P8/documents/101014318. Issue happens whether you are on IP or analog phone. All other integration seems to be working. WMI lamps work. The CMM and CM are on s8300e AVP with 3 g450s for DSP/VOIP resources. The MGs are on latest firmware 38.20.1. What am I missing?

    YOu may need to check below parameters between SIP signalling group on CM and switch link Administration on CMM

    DTMF over IP

    rtp-payload
    if
    SIP INFO for DTMF
    field is set to
    Ignore
    on the Switch Link Admin form.

    out-of-band
    if
    SIP INFO for DTMF
    field is set to
    Accept
    on the Switch Link Admin form.

          SIGNALING GROUP

          Group Number: 10 Group Type: sip
          IMS Enabled? n Transport Method: tcp
          Q-SIP? n
          IP Video? n Enforce SIPS URI for SRTP? y
          Peer Detection Enabled? y Peer Server: Others
          Prepend '+' to Outgoing Calling/Alerting/Diverting/Connected Public Numbers? n
          Remove '+' from Incoming Called/Calling/Alerting/Diverting/Connected Numbers? y
          Alert Incoming SIP Crisis Calls? n
          Near-end Node Name: procr Far-end Node Name: msgserver
          Near-end Listen Port: 5060 Far-end Listen Port: 6060
          Far-end Network Region: 1

          Far-end Domain: rescue.org
          Bypass If IP Threshold Exceeded? n
          Incoming Dialog Loopbacks: eliminate RFC 3389 Comfort Noise? n
          DTMF over IP: rtp-payload Direct IP-IP Audio Connections? y
          Session Establishment Timer(min): 3 IP Audio Hairpinning? n
          Enable Layer 3 Test? y Initial IP-IP Direct Media? n
          H.323 Station Outgoing Direct Media? n Alternate Route Timer(sec): 6

                  The problem was solved. The reason was in the table "public-unknown-numbering". I have added string for my local stations and trunk to CMM and it's ok.
